2. The Psychology of Patterns in Games
Humans Seek Predictability and Structure
Research shows that humans have an innate preference for predictability. This tendency helps reduce cognitive load and provides a sense of control. In gaming, players often look for familiar patterns—such as recurring enemy behaviors or predictable reward schedules—to develop strategies and feel competent. This behavior is rooted in our evolutionary need to anticipate and adapt to environmental cues for survival.
Cognitive Biases Influencing Decisions
Several biases shape decision-making in games. For example, the gambler’s fallacy leads players to expect a change after a series of similar outcomes—like believing a losing streak in a slot machine indicates an impending win. Similarly, pattern recognition can cause players to see connections where none exist, impacting their choices and risking fallacious strategies. These biases are well-documented in behavioral economics and psychology, emphasizing their relevance in gaming behavior.
Role of Emotions and Reinforcement
Emotional responses, such as excitement or frustration, reinforce certain decision patterns. Positive reinforcement—like winning a reward—encourages players to repeat specific behaviors, while negative emotions might deter risky choices. These emotional cues are strategically embedded in game design to maintain engagement and influence decision patterns over time.
3. Recognizing and Responding to Patterns: From Simple to Complex
Basic Pattern Recognition in Early Game Stages
In initial gameplay, players often identify straightforward patterns, such as timing cues or predictable enemy movements. For instance, early in a slot game, players may notice certain symbols appear more frequently or in specific sequences, guiding their bets and strategies.
Advanced Pattern Detection and Strategic Impact
As players gain experience, they develop the ability to detect more subtle and complex patterns—like micro-timing cues or behavioral tendencies of opponents in competitive games. Recognizing these micro-patterns allows for sophisticated strategies, such as predictable bluffing in poker or exploiting algorithmic biases in digital games.
Examples from Classic and Modern Games
Classic games like chess exemplify strategic pattern recognition, where players anticipate opponents’ moves based on established openings. Modern digital games leverage dynamic pattern recognition; for example, mobile games adapt challenges based on player behavior, subtly guiding decision patterns to increase engagement and monetization.

7. Non-Obvious Patterns and Deep Behavioral Insights
Hidden Patterns in Prolonged Gameplay
Players often develop micro-patterns over extended play sessions—such as timing their bets or reacting to subtle visual cues—that influence outcomes subconsciously. Recognizing these micro-patterns can provide strategic advantages or lead to predictable behaviors exploited by skilled players or designers.
Subconscious Decision Cues
Micro-cues like slight animations, sound triggers, or interface layouts can subconsciously guide decisions. For instance, a flashing icon might prompt a player to act quickly, reinforcing impulsive behavior. Game designers leverage these micro-patterns to subtly steer choices without overtly revealing their intentions.
Importance of Subtle Cues
Incorporating subtle cues into game design enhances engagement and can influence decision patterns at a subconscious level. This understanding is vital for both creators aiming to craft compelling experiences and players seeking to recognize potential manipulations.

Algorithms and AI Influences
Advanced AI and machine learning algorithms analyze player behavior to personalize experiences, subtly guiding decision patterns. For example, in some digital games, AI might introduce novel challenges when players show signs of fatigue or boredom, maintaining engagement through dynamic pattern adjustments.
Implications Beyond Gaming
These technological advances have broader implications, revealing how pattern-based engagement tactics influence decision-making in areas like social media, online shopping, and targeted advertising. Recognizing these patterns helps in understanding the mechanics behind digital influence and behavioral manipulation in everyday life.
